080

PR6

Lenze · 9300 Series

What does 080 mean?

The device has reached the maximum allowed number of user codes. This prevents the creation or storage of additional user-defined settings.

Common Causes

  • Excessive creation of new user parameter sets (profiles) without deleting older, unused ones.
  • Automated systems or programming tools repeatedly attempting to save new user configurations, exceeding internal limits.
  • A specific user parameter set has grown too large, consuming multiple allocated memory slots.
  • Firmware limitation on the total number or maximum size of user-defined parameter sets.
